A veterinary assistant may perform the following tasks under the immediate or direct supervision of a supervising veterinarian or a licensed veterinary technician: (a) Blood administration with a preplaced catheter. (b) Monitoring of vital signs. (c) Administration of an electrocardiogram. WebWith practice, however, you should be able to palpate the “vein” through even thick layers of vet wrap. 4.
